Apple planning iPhone and iPod touch price cuts?

9to5Mac has received word that Apple is planning on dropping the prices on the iPhone and iPod line within the next month or two - perhaps at the rumoured late February event. The price cut is said to be $100 on both the iPod touch and iPhone lines - and the 8GB iPod touch will apparently be dropped from the line-up just as the 4GB version of the iPhone was before it. If true, this means that the 16GB iPhone will be $399 - the current price for the 8GB version and the 32GB iPod touch will come in at $399 too. Following the same cost cut pattern, considering the difference in pricing, this means the UK could expect to see the 32GB iPod touch and 16GB iPhone both at £269. 9to5Mac predicts the price drops are in order to make way for "pricing space" for the 3G iPhone, expected this year.
